How Our Same Day Water Removal Process Works

When you call us for same day water removal, our team springs into action. We know that every minute counts, and we’ll work tirelessly to get your home back to normal as soon as possible. Here’s what you can expect from our process:

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ll send a team of experts to assess the damage and create a plan to get your home dry and safe. This includes identifying the source of the water and determining the best course of action to prevent further damage. Our team will also take photos and notes to document the damage for your insurance company.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our team will use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ract as much water as possible from your home’s floors, walls, and ceilings. We’ll also use specialized equipment to dry out the affected areas and prevent m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ry out your home and prevent further damage. This process can take several days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the water is removed and the area is dry, our team will clean and sanitize the affected areas to prevent mold and bacteria growth. We’ll also use specialized equipment to remove any remaining moisture and prevent future damage.

Step 5: Restoration and Repairs

Finally, our team will work with you to restore your home to its original condition. This may include repairs to walls, floors, and ceilings, as well as replacing any damaged materials. We’ll also work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.

Same Day Water Removal Cost in Plantation, FL

The cost of same day water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Plantation, FL. Here are some estimated costs for common scenarios: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Water damage repair and rest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ed.
Mold remediation and removal $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Dehumidification and air movement $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Water damage inspection and ass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area and severity of damage.
Water damage prevention and prevention measures $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to all our customers. Don’t wait, call us today to schedule your same day water removal service.
